The efficient handling of steel containers is crucial for the transportation industry, as it ensures the safe and timely delivery of goods. In this video, we will explore the various methods used to lift and unload steel containers, including manual lifting techniques, crane operations, and automated systems.

Manual Lift Techniques
Mangapet One of the most common methods of lifting steel containers involves using a forklift truck or a team of workers. The container is first secured with straps or chains, and then lifted by the forklift or workers. This method requires careful coordination between the operators and the lifting equipment, as any misalignment can cause damage to the container or the equipment.
Crane Operations
Crane operations are another effective method for lifting steel containers. A crane is attached to the container using a chain or winch, and then raised into position for unloading. This method is particularly useful when dealing with large or heavy containers, as it allows for precise placement of the container on the loading dock.
Mangapet Automated Systems
Mangapet In recent years, there has been a growing trend towards automation in the shipping industry. Automated systems use robotic arms and sensors to lift and unload steel containers with greater accuracy and efficiency. These systems can be programmed to perform specific tasks, such as stacking containers or loading them onto trucks, without the need for human intervention.
Conclusion
Mangapet The methods used to lift and unload steel containers vary depending on the size, weight, and type of container being handled. Manual techniques require careful coordination between operators and equipment, while crane operations and automated systems offer greater precision and efficiency.
